2002 Dakota Territory Challenge
The 2002 Dakota Territory Challenge occurred as normal on Labor Day weekend, despite a very dry Summer and fires that has threatened to shut down the event as late as the first weeks of August. Some trails such as Bikini and T-Back were not accessible due to the Rockerville fire, but the BH 4 Wheelers more than made up for it by opening some tough new sections of the Hal Johns Trail. |

ProROCK - Season Finale - Fernley, Nevada 2002
Close to Reno, Nevada, the Fernley Raceway proved to be a great event location for rock-crawling. This was the first ProROCK competition run on man-made obstacles. The man-made courses worked well, affording spectators the opportunity to view a number of obstacles from one location. The breakage toll was still high, as numerous axle shafts, pinions, and tie rods lost their battles with the rocks, but the layout of the courses also provided a high degree of difficulty without the imminent danger of multiple rollovers that can wreak havoc on competitors and equipment. |
